Welcome to Ravensford ...

Ravensford is located in Swain County<1>.

While we don't have a date for the founding of Ravensford, you might consider that their post office opened in 1919.

Ravensford is 2,170 feet [661 m] above sea level.<2> In other words, the altitude of Ravensford is about ½ mile above sea level.

Time Zone: Ravensford l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Area Code for Ravensford: 828

Adding Ravensford to Our Gazetteer ...

We originally found mention of Ravensford in both the FIPS-55 and the GNIS. For more information, see the FIPS and GNIS Codes sections on our Miscellaneous Page.

From our notes, the earliest published mention we've found (so far) for Ravensford was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<4>

From that list, the Ravensford post office opened in 1919. The Ravensford post office closed in 1943.
